


Inside: USA is a one-of-a-kind, high-stakes reality show that spans a week and features 12 contestants battling it out for $1 million. The only catch is that they enter the house with nothing but the clothes on their backs –– everything inside costs a hefty price that’s directly deducted from the prize pot.
The first season of Inside, from a group of seven British content creators known as the Sidemen (Behzinga, W2S, Zerkaa, KSI, Miniminter, TBJZL, and Vikkstar123), became a massive hit on YouTube in 2024. Audiences eagerly tuned in to watch contestants live in a house with few allotted amenities, taking cold showers and eating a repetitive meal of rice and beans in the hopes of winning £1 million — a fund that rapidly dwindled every time they took a hot shower, bought snacks, or lost challenges.
Inside Season 2 premiered March 17, delivering another installment of high-stakes high jinks, and now Inside: USA brings the diabolical shenanigans to America.
